Remember when John Edwards was going across the country in a One America/Live Aid sort of deal? Or how about when the cast of <em>Good Morning America took a train on a "whistle stop tour" to see how the election is shaping up? Yeah, CNN's idea for a road trip is even worse.

CNN announced Thursday that Cooper will file recession-related dispatches from five U.S. cities as part of a weeklong special package of economy-related coverage branded "Road to the Rescue: A CNN Survival Guide."
